Full Itinerary
Day 1: Arrival in Torres del Paine (D)
The trip starts in Punta Arenas or Puerto Natales either at your hotel or at the airport. Drive to the Torres del Paine National Park.
If you start in Punta Arenas, you will stop in Puerto Natales on the shores of Seno Ultima Esperanza - "Last Hope Sound". Here you will enjoy a hearty lunch with delicious local food. It is a 3-hour drive from Punta Arenas to Puerto Natales.
This scenic journey ends with our arrival at EcoCamp Patagonia, nestled in the heart of Torres del Paine National Park with a prime view of the majestic Paine Towers. It is a 2-hour drive from Puerto Natales to Torres del Paine.
Meals included: Dinner
Mid-Range Accommodations: EcoCamp
Day 2: Trek the Los Cuernos trail (BLD)
We start our Patagonian adventure with a pleasant walk along the Cuernos Trail which leads to the beautiful Lake Nordenskjold. During this warm-up walk, we will have the opportunity to admire the park's exquisite flora and fauna and take in the views of the horn-like peaks of slate that sit atop the gray granite of the Paine Massif. The trek may end at Camping Los Cuernos, a small and cozy mountain guesthouse located on the shores of Lake Nordenskjold. Or it will end at Camping Frances, located between Cuernos and Italiano camping sites, with an amazing view of Nordenskjold Lake. Overnight depends on availability, and a dorm upgrade may be available.
- Hiking Distance: 12 km/7.5 mi
- Hiking Time: 4-5 hrs
- Max. Altitude: 244 m/800 ft
- Elevation gain: 300 m/1148 ft

Day 3: Trek Valle del Frances trail (BLD)
We begin hiking along a steep trail leading into the heart of the Paine Massif - the French Valley. How far we will go depends on our group's rhythm. A swifter walk will lead us to a hanging bridge, located at the foot of the south-eastern face of the Massif. We will continue to ascend towards the upper section of the valley to marvel at the extensive mass of the geological formations: Hoja (Blade), Mascara (Mask), Espada (Sword), among others. After our upward trek, we will pause for a picnic and relax for a while. The hike will end with a descent through a terrain of mixed grassland and light forest to Camping Paine Grande (dorm upgrade may be available).
Please note: An optional trek to Mirador Britanico is also possible with previous coordination with the guides.
- Hiking Distance: 20 Km/12.4 Mi (If you are hiking to Mirador Británico, additional 4 Km / 2.4 Mi.)
- Hiking Time: 10 hrs
- Max. Altitude: 686 m/2250 ft
- Elevation gain: 820 m/2690 ft

Day 4: Trek Pehoe - Grey trail (BLD)
Today we will hike from the Paine Grande Refugio along the shores of Lake Pehoe to the northern side of Lake Grey. We will feast on a picnic lunch before boarding the boat that sails to the crystalline facade of Glacier Grey. From the southern end of the glacier, we will transfer to EcoCamp. Due to the weather of the region, boat trips across the lake may occasionally be canceled or if the required minimum of 15 passengers is not reached. If this is the case, we will trek up to a sightseeing point to enjoy wonderful views of Grey Glacier instead. Afterward, it is time to return on foot to Paine Grande and take a catamaran to the dock, where we will be picked up and driven to EcoCamp.
- Hiking Distance: 11 km/6.8 mi
- Hiking Time: 4 hrs
- Max. Altitude: 244 m/800 ft
- Elevation gain: 271 m/889 ft

Day 5: Trek to the Towers (BLD)
Today is the big day, the walk to the base of the Paine Towers. We will hike towards Hosteria Las Torres before ascending to Ascencio Valley on the Tower's eastern face, flanked by mountain ridges, beech forests, and small rivers. Our big challenge is the steep moraine, a huge mass of boulders that lead to the iconic Towers base, the three granite monoliths that are the remains of a great cirque sheared away by glacial ice. After a tough uphill climb, the Towers rise majestically before us with the glacial lake visible below. After enjoying the view, we will use the same trail to return to EcoCamp for a well-deserved dinner.
- Hiking Distance: 22 km/14 mi
- Hiking Time: 9 hrs
- Max. Altitude: 897 m/2942 ft
- Elevation gain: 1023 m/3356 ft

Day 6: Hike the Eastern Lakes (BLD)
For the last hike, we will take it easy with a scenic drive to Sarmiento Lake's northern shore to start the less demanding Aonikenk Trail. Hiking north, we will encounter diverse Patagonian wildlife and perhaps puma tracks, passing Goic Lagoon to reach Laguna Amarga ranger station after a leisurely 5 km walk. Post-lunch, we head to Laguna Azul, spotting wild guanacos and nandus en route, and savoring various views of the Patagonian steppe and the Towers. At Laguna Azul, a short hike takes us to a lookout for stunning views of the lagoon and granite towers, finishing the day with a drive back to EcoCamp for a celebratory farewell dinner.
- Hiking Distance: 6 km/3.72 mi
- Hiking Time: 3 hrs
- Max. Altitude: 300 m/984 ft
- Elevation gain: 267 m/ 876 ft
